Chinaunix首页 | 论坛 | 博客
  • 博客访问: 386067
  • 博文数量: 112
  • 博客积分: 10
  • 博客等级: 民兵
  • 技术积分: 800
  • 用 户 组: 普通用户
  • 注册时间: 2010-12-29 13:41
文章分类

全部博文(112)

文章存档

2020年(1)

2018年(10)

2017年(27)

2016年(18)

2015年(31)

2014年(25)

发布时间:2015-04-02 16:45:16

Ⅰ、处理多行模式空间(N、D、P)。N命令:追加下一行多行Next(N)命令通过读取当前行的下一行,并把两行拼成一行来进行接下来的处理。$ cat fileline 1line 2line 3line 4file文件中的每一行后面都有一个隐藏的换行符”\n”,sed不对每行末尾的”\n”进行处理。$ sed N fileline 1.........【阅读全文】

阅读(1077) | 评论(0) | 转发(0)

发布时间:2015-04-01 16:00:08

bash里面的#这个提示符前的内容是可以修改的:先看看操作系统版本[jim@localhost /]$ lsb_release -aLSB Version: :core-3.1-ia32:core-3.1-noarch:core-3.2-ia32:core-3.2-noarch:desktop-3.1-ia32:desktop-3.1-noarch:desktop-3.2-ia32:desktop-3.2-noarchDistributor ID: FedoraDescription: Fedora rele.........【阅读全文】

阅读(692) | 评论(0) | 转发(0)

发布时间:2015-03-27 17:31:06

sed高级命令:一、模式空间(pattern space):N;追加下一行(把文件两行看作一行),多行Next(N)命令通过读取当前行的下一行,并把两行组成一行来进行接下来的处理。$!N;使用N的时候加一个判断,即当前行为最后一行时,不读取下一行的内容:n;读取下一行(读取文件的偶数行),用下一个命令处理读取的行。P;打印模式空.........【阅读全文】

阅读(842) | 评论(0) | 转发(0)

发布时间:2015-03-27 10:13:10

LINUX Shell脚本中点号和source命令LINUX中一个文件是根据其是否具有执行属性来判断他是否可以直接运行的。就像windows下的exe一样。如果我们要执行某一个文件,可以先将其权限修改为可执行(必须是所有者或者root才能修改)。然后,通过用sh来执行该脚本或者./脚本名。但有时候我们并不想修改文件权限,可能我们也没有.........【阅读全文】

阅读(1138) | 评论(0) | 转发(0)

发布时间:2015-03-16 16:43:09

1 shell变量基础shell变量是一种很“弱”的变量,默认情况下,一个变量保存一个串,shell不关心这个串是什么含义。所以若要进行数学运算,必须使用一些命令例如let、declare、expr、双括号等。shell变量可分为两类:局部变量和环境变量。局部变量只在创建它们的shell中可用。而环境变量则可以在创建它们的shell及其派生.........【阅读全文】

阅读(1145) | 评论(0) | 转发(0)
给主人留下些什么吧!~~
留言热议
请登录后留言。

登录 注册